Distributed computing courses can help you learn parallel processing, cloud architecture, data distribution techniques, and fault tolerance. You can build skills in optimizing resource allocation, ensuring data consistency, and managing large-scale applications. Many courses introduce tools like Apache Hadoop, Spark, and Kubernetes, that support implementing distributed systems and managing workloads effectively.

Skills you'll gain: Apache Hadoop, Apache Hive, Big Data, Database Design, Data Integration, Social Media Analytics, Extensible Markup Language (XML), Database Management Systems, Database Management, JSON, Data Processing, Distributed Computing, Data Analysis, Analytics, Scalability, Extensible Languages and XML, Data Pipelines, Query Languages, Data Cleansing, Dataflow
Intermediate · Specialization · 3 - 6 Months

Skills you'll gain: Continuous Delivery, Software Development Tools, Site Reliability Engineering, Event Monitoring, Incident Management, Test Tools, Development Environment, Memory Management, Incident Response, Performance Testing, Root Cause Analysis, Distributed Computing, CI/CD
Beginner · Course · 1 - 4 Weeks

Skills you'll gain: Model Optimization, Cloud Computing Architecture, Cloud Management, Model Training, Cloud Infrastructure, Distributed Computing, Data Pipelines, Managed Services, Cost Management, Cost Benefit Analysis
Intermediate · Course · 1 - 4 Weeks

Skills you'll gain: Scalability, Software Design Patterns, Node.JS, Distributed Computing, Dataflow, Data Pipelines, Event-Driven Programming, Object Oriented Design, Software Design, Software Architecture, Performance Tuning, Live Streaming, Real Time Data, Systems Architecture, File I/O, Javascript, Object Oriented Programming (OOP), Code Reusability, Maintainability, OS Process Management
Intermediate · Specialization · 3 - 6 Months

Skills you'll gain: PySpark, Apache Hadoop, Apache Spark, Big Data, Apache Hive, Analytics, Data Processing, Distributed Computing, Debugging, Java Programming
Intermediate · Course · 1 - 4 Weeks

Skills you'll gain: Apache Mahout, NoSQL, Big Data, Apache Hive, Data Pipelines, Databases, Applied Machine Learning, Real Time Data, Database Theory, Scalability, Distributed Computing, Data Processing, Database Architecture and Administration, Model Evaluation, Machine Learning Algorithms, Transaction Processing, Classification Algorithms
Mixed · Course · 1 - 4 Weeks

Skills you'll gain: Apache Hadoop, Apache Hive, Big Data, Database Design, Data Processing, Distributed Computing, Scalability, Data Pipelines, Query Languages, Data Cleansing, Data Transformation, Data Management, Analytics, Data Preprocessing, Ad Hoc Reporting, Data Analysis
Mixed · Course · 1 - 4 Weeks

Skills you'll gain: Test Case, Test Automation, Test Tools, Continuous Integration, Test Data, Functional Testing, Test Execution Engine, CI/CD, Software Testing, Test Engineering, No-Code Development, Code Reusability, Maintainability, Distributed Computing
Beginner · Course · 1 - 4 Weeks

Skills you'll gain: NoSQL, Real Time Data, Query Languages, Scalability, Database Design, Application Deployment, Data Infrastructure, Big Data, Data Access, Data Manipulation, Performance Tuning, Data Modeling, Distributed Computing, Data Storage Technologies
Beginner · Course · 1 - 4 Weeks

Skills you'll gain: Apache Hadoop, Big Data, Application Deployment, Social Network Analysis, Data Processing, Distributed Computing, Java, Text Mining, Graph Theory, File I/O
Mixed · Course · 1 - 3 Months

Skills you'll gain: NoSQL, Operational Databases, Data Migration, Database Administration, Database Architecture and Administration, Relational Databases, PostgreSQL, Database Management, Database Design, SQL, Google Cloud Platform, Data Store, Distributed Computing, MySQL, Database Management Systems, System Configuration, Data Access, Disaster Recovery, System Monitoring, Cloud Deployment
Intermediate · Specialization · 1 - 3 Months

Birla Institute of Technology & Science, Pilani
Skills you'll gain: Object Oriented Design, Software Architecture, Software Design, Software Design Patterns, Object Oriented Programming (OOP), Software Development Life Cycle, Software Development, Software Engineering, Maintainability, System Design and Implementation, Service Oriented Architecture, Technical Design, Web Services, Model View Controller, Event-Driven Programming, Distributed Computing
Build toward a degree
Intermediate · Course · 1 - 3 Months